Well,
The front, nice as it is, is a waste of money. You'll spend so much you'll be afraid to use it as a daily driver. However, if thats what floats your boat, you'd be the first, and have a gorgeous car.

As for the rear, its simple. Get 'the artist formerly known as syndicate-bro's' rear 'skyline' center panel. This allows the rear sides to remain, and gives two circles next to them. You can replace the sides (the part of the tails that actually lights up) with whatever aftermarket tails you want. Then just have a bodyshop make the panel flush with the trunk and paint to match. This is fairly inexpensive (as far as bodywork goes that is).
Instant IS300/altezza (the car not the lights) rear end.
